I can't believe how horrible the formatting process for emails with Constant Contact is. It randomly changes fonts and font sizes, refuses to accept changes, the actual email looks different from the preview, and so on and on. Surely you guys can come up with something better than this? This is simply not acceptable.

I agree. You want to tear your hair out and it shouldn't be this difficult. You change the fonts and size. Everything looks good. You save it and it goes back to doing whatever the hell it wants to.....and this can happen multiple times within the same box. It doesn't matter if you remove the formatting or not. I spend as much time trying to correct this as I do composing the messages. Sometimes I just give up.

BTW. I do paste things in notepad first which does help somewhat however copying a recurring message and adding content still results in the same frustrations. I don't understand why you can make universal changes or why removing formatting doesn't permanently remove the formatting.
Constant Contact just announced that they will be rolling out their new editor very soon. Their claims are that these problems will be solved. I am cautiously optimistic.

If the announced changes don't make formatting much easier, we'll revert to doing our newsletter in Publisher and attaching it as a PDF. Though there is concern about emails with attachments being blocked, the current formatting issues are a real pain.

I'm a Mac user and I've found that using Firefox instead of Safari makes a world of difference. I can see what I'm doing and what the actual newsletter is going to look like while I'm working on it.
